  • Tomcat can't get the specified jsp-page.

    there are three jsp-page : Step1.jsp Step2.jsp Step3.jsp
    Step2.jsp and Step3.jsp are placed at the same folder,but Step3.jsp is placed at the different folder.
    Step1.jsp's content :
    request.getRequestDispatcher("/CH4/Step2.jsp").forward(request,response);
    Step2.jsp's content :
    <form name="form1" action="Step3.jsp" method="post">
    <input type="submit" name="submit" value="submit">
    </form>
    Step3.jsp's content :
    <c:out value="can you see this page " />
    the expectent procedure is : Step1 -> Step2 ->Step3
    but there is error : The requested resource (/CH4/MyJspCode/Step3.jsp) is not available.
    how to currect it ?

    The action on your form will be relative to step1.jsp
    So it will look for step3.jsp in the same folder as step1.jsp.
    This is because:
    The request was for step1.jsp
    The action attribute is a relative reference, not absolute, and thus is relative to the requested url - step1.jsp
    Although it was forwarded to step2.jsp, the browser knows nothing of this, and thus uses step1.jsp as its base.
    You can change this by including a base tag on the page.
    You can also give an absolute reference to the servlet/jsp but that involves harcoding the context name into the URL.

  • Display image on jsp page

    I have to display image on jsp page with some text output. This image is already saved at a location parallel to web-inf and is generated dynamically using a servlet. I have used img tag html to display the image. Other outputs are taking their values from database.
    First problem is that image will be taking time to display in comparision of other outouts from database. I have to refresh the page to get imageon my page.
    Second is that if I save image in a folder parallel to web-inf in my project then it will not be displaying the image.
    Can I use any jsp functionality to display image with other outputs from database. I have used "*include*". but it shows only that image and other outputs.

    Best way is to use a servlet for this.
    <img src="path/to/imageservlet?id=someidentifier">
    <!-- or -->
    <img src="path/to/imageservlet/someidentifier">In the servlet's doGet() just write code which gets an InputStream of the image (either directly generated, or just read from the local disk file system, if necessary with help of ServletContext#getRealPath(), or even from the DB by ResultSet#getBinaryStream()) and writes it to the OutputStream of the response. That's basically all. Don't forget to buffer the streams properly to speedup performance and to save memory.
